For those who may not have prior experience or qualifications, a range of beginner courses is accessible in Karama. The Provide First Aid (HLTAID011) and its related courses, including Provide Basic Emergency Life Support (HLTAID010) and Provide First Aid in an Education and Care Setting (HLTAID012), equip learners with crucial emergency skills necessary for any educational environment. Students can also acquire life-saving skills through Provide Cardiopulmonary Resuscitation (CPR) (HLTAID009).
Experienced learners seeking to further their qualifications can benefit from the advanced Diploma of Early Childhood Education and Care (CHC50121). This course is aimed at individuals looking to enhance their expertise and take on more significant responsibilities within childcare settings. With a robust curriculum covering leadership skills and advanced pedagogical strategies, it provides the foundation for career advancement in the industry.
